What is a Vacuum Robot?
A vacuum robot, or robotic vacuum, is a self-governing cleaning gadget that vacuums floorings without manual intervention. These compact devices use numerous technologies to browse, detect dirt, and effectively clean different surface areas. With sound levels comparable to standard vacuums and ingrained smart functions, vacuum robots have actually become progressively popular amongst hectic households.

How Does a Vacuum Robot Work?
The underlying technology of vacuum robots can appear complex, however the majority of designs operate using similar principles. Here's a streamlined breakdown of how a common vacuum robot works:
Mapping: The robot vac scans the environment using sensors, creating a map of the area for efficient cleaning patterns.
Navigation: Using the gathered data, the robot devises a cleaning path, navigating around obstacles while guaranteeing it covers the entire floor location.
Suction and Cleaning: The robot engages its cleaning system, utilizing suction and brushes to gather dirt and particles into its dustbin.
Charging: Once its battery is low or the cleaning cycle is total, the robot go back to its charging dock to charge.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How often should I run my vacuum robot?
It is suggested to run your vacuum robot a minimum of as soon as every couple of days or daily if you have pets or a high foot traffic location. Regular use helps maintain cleanliness and prevents dirt accumulation.
2. Can vacuum robots link to Wi-Fi?
Yes, numerous modern vacuum robots are geared up with Wi-Fi capabilities, enabling users to manage them through mobile phone apps and integrate them with smart home gadgets.
3. Do vacuum robots tidy corners successfully?
While a lot of vacuum robots make use of a round design, numerous included corner-cleaning modes and unique brush configurations that enable them to navigate corners more efficiently.
4. Are vacuum robots worth the financial investment?
Whether a vacuum robot deserves it depends on private cleaning needs and lifestyle. For hectic individuals and households, the convenience and performance it provides can make it a valuable financial investment.
5. How do I keep my vacuum robot?
Routine upkeep includes emptying the dustbin after each usage, inspecting and changing filters as needed, and cleaning the brushes to prevent hair and debris buildup.
